From: Gene expression analysis reveals diabetes-related gene signatures
Study | Dataset | Human pancreatic islets samples | Sample isolation method | Protocol design | |
---|---|---|---|---|---|
Total n° | Type | ||||
Doi: https://0-doi-org.brum.beds.ac.uk/10.1038/s42255-021-00420-9 | GSE164416 | 57 | 18 ND, 39 T2D | Laser capture microdissection | SMART-seq Illumina Hiseq 2500 or 500 |
Doi: https://0-doi-org.brum.beds.ac.uk/10.1074/jbc.M110.200295 | GSE25724 | 13 | 7 ND, 6 T2D | Collagenase digestion followed by density gradient purification | HG- U133A Affymetrix chips |
Doi: https://0-doi-org.brum.beds.ac.uk/10.1371/journal.pone.0011499 | GSE20966 | 20 | 10 ND, 10 T2D | Laser capture microdissection | DNA-Chip Analyzer |
Doi: https://0-doi-org.brum.beds.ac.uk/10.1007/s00125-017-4500-3 | GSE76894 | 103 | 84 ND, 19 T2D | Enzymatic digestion or laser capture microdissection | Affymetrix Human Genome U133 Plus 2.0 Array |
Doi: https://0-doi-org.brum.beds.ac.uk/10.1101/gr.212720.116 | GSE86473 | 8 | 5 ND, 3 T2D | Cultured and isolated via C1 integrated fluidic circuit | SMART-seq2 Illumina NextSeq500 |
Doi: https://0-doi-org.brum.beds.ac.uk/10.1016/j.cmet.2020.04.005 | GSE124742 | 6 | 3 ND, 3 T1D | Patch-seq and FACS | SMART-seq2 Illumina NextSeq500 or Novaseq platform |
